Richard A. Demers is a scholar working on Language and Linguistics, Linguistics and Language and Computer Networks and Communications. According to data from OpenAlex, Richard A. Demers has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 261 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Language and Linguistics, 6 papers in Linguistics and Language and 3 papers in Computer Networks and Communications. Recurrent topics in Richard A. Demers's work include Linguistic Variation and Morphology (6 papers), Syntax, Semantics, Linguistic Variation (6 papers) and Spanish Linguistics and Language Studies (4 papers). Richard A. Demers is often cited by papers focused on Linguistic Variation and Morphology (6 papers), Syntax, Semantics, Linguistic Variation (6 papers) and Spanish Linguistics and Language Studies (4 papers). Richard A. Demers collaborates with scholars based in United States. Richard A. Demers's co-authors include Eloise Jelinek, Robert M. Harnish, Adrian Akmajian, Peter Hawkins, Ann Farmer and Ralph Penny and has published in prestigious journals such as Communications of the ACM, Language and IBM Systems Journal.
